Te Taki (Breadfruit in Coconut Cream)

Te Taki is a simple yet delicious traditional Kiribati dish where tender breadfruit is slow-cooked in rich coconut cream until it achieves a creamy, melt-in-your-mouth texture. It's a comforting dish that highlights the natural flavors of its core ingredients.

Prep Time15 minutes
Cook Time40 minutes
Total Time55 minutes
Servings4
DifficultyEasy

🧂 Ingredients

  • 1 large Breadfruit(ripe, about 900g)
  • 500 ml Coconut cream(full fat)
  • 1 tsp Salt(or to taste)
  • 100 ml Water(optional, to adjust consistency)
  • 0.5 medium Onion(optional, finely chopped)
  • 2 cloves Garlic(optional, minced)
  • 1 small Chili(optional, finely chopped)

👨‍🍳 Instructions

  1. 1

    Peel the breadfruit, cut it into medium-sized chunks, and remove the core. Place the pieces in a bowl of water to prevent browning.

    💡 Tip: Using a sharp knife will make peeling easier. The core can be fibrous, so ensure it's removed.
  2. 2

    In a large pot, add the coconut cream and bring it to a gentle simmer over medium heat.

    💡 Tip: Do not boil the coconut cream vigorously; a gentle simmer is best.
  3. 3

    Drain the breadfruit pieces and add them to the simmering coconut cream. Add salt to taste. If using, add chopped onion, garlic, or chili.

    💡 Tip: Stir gently to coat the breadfruit evenly.
  4. 4

    Cover the pot and reduce the heat to low. Let the breadfruit simmer for 30-40 minutes, or until tender.

    💡 Tip: Stir occasionally to prevent sticking. Add a little water if the mixture becomes too thick.
  5. 5

    Once tender, stir gently and taste for seasoning. Adjust salt if needed.

    💡 Tip: The breadfruit should be soft and creamy, having absorbed some of the coconut cream.
  6. 6

    Transfer to a serving dish and serve warm.

    💡 Tip: This dish can be served as a side or a light main course.

💡 Pro Tips

  • If fresh coconut is unavailable, good quality canned coconut cream works well.
  • The optional additions of onion, garlic, and chili can add a savory depth to the dish.

🔄 Variations

  • Add a pinch of nutmeg or cinnamon for a different flavor profile.
  • Serve with a drizzle of honey or syrup for a sweeter version.
